Inter coach Antonio Conte hailed his
side's spirit after they beat Borussia Moenchengladbach 3-2 away
on Tuesday to keep alive their hopes of reaching the Champions
League last 16.
Romelu Lukaku scored twice and Darmian was also on target in
Germany.
They remain bottom of Group B with five points but they will
progress if they beat Shakhtar Donetsk in their last group game
at the San Siro and Real Madrid and Moenchengladbach do not draw
in the other match.
"We produced a great performance and showed desire and
determination and we ended up with a deserved victory," said
Conte.
"We could have avoided having to dig in quite so much, but we're
still alive in the Champions League and this is the most
important thing.
"We have the right spirit, and we can cause our opponents
problems when the lads have this attitude."
